Plot: Made by famed director, G.W. Pabst, at UFA, under the Third Reich, Paracelsus is the story of the Renaissance era Swiss physician/alchemist/astrologer,, Philippus Aureolus Theophrastus Bombastus von Hohenheim. Though Pabst had tried,, he was unable to escape the Nazis, and was forced to direct under the Third Reich's auspices. Though Nazi-era system has, in large part been banned but omission of public showings, many films of this period and regime are quite good (or at minimum, interesting), as they hold up a mirror to the Nazis propaganda machine controlled by Joseph Goebbels.
